C# DataTableのnullの値を参照しようとしてエラー時の対処

DataSet,DataTable,DataRowのnullの値の参照

エラー

System.Data.StrongTypingException が発生しました
Message=テーブル ‘Table1’ にある列 ‘Row1’ の値は DBNull です。
InvalidCastException: 型 ‘System.DBNull’ のオブジェクトを型 ‘System.String’ にキャストできません。

対処法

DataRow.IscolumnnameNull プロパティを使用します。
例  ) if ( IsRow1Null() )

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です

This site uses Akismet to reduce spam. Learn how your comment data is processed.